Body
Origins and Family
Thomas Crosland was born on 1815[2]. His father was George Crosland[6]. His mother was Mary Anne Pearson[7].
Career and Affiliations
Thomas Crosland's professions included politician[4]. He held the position of member of the 19th Parliament of the United Kingdom[9].
Personal Life
Thomas Crosland was affiliated with the Liberal Party[12].
Death and Burial
Recorded date of death include 1868[3] and March 8, 1868[5].
